客戶至上·專業至上
客戶至上,專業第一

php怎麼實現數據的增删改查

來源:沐陽科技 作者:網站建設 2024-01-04 09:48:06 0

在PHP中,我們通常使用MySQL資料庫來執行增删改查操作。 以下是一個簡單的示例:

連接資料庫:在操作數據之前,我們需要先建立資料庫連接。

&;? php$servername=“ 本地主機”$ 用戶名=“ 用戶名”$ 密碼=“ 密碼”$ dbname=“ myDB// 創建連接$conn=新mysqli($servername、$username、$password、$dbname)// 檢查連接if($connect->;connect_error){die(“連接保險:”$connect-<;connect_error);}& gt;

        新增數據:假設有一個名為myTable的錶,我們可以向其中添加一條新記錄。

$sql=“; 在myTable中插入(名字、姓氏、電子郵件)值(“John”、“Doe”、“ john@example.com ')";; if($conn->;query($sql)===TRUE){echo“新記錄輸入功能”;} else{echo“錯誤:”.$sql.“<;br>;”.$conn->;錯誤;}

        删除數據:可以通過DELETE語句删除數據。

$sql=“; 從myTable中删除id=3“;; if($conn->;query($sql)===TRUE){echo“記錄失敗”;} else{echo“删除記錄時出錯:”.$conn->;Error;}

        修改數據:使用UPDATE語句可以更新已存在的數據。

$sql=“; 更新myTable SET姓氏='Doe',其中id=2“;; if($conn->;query($sql)===TRUE){echo“記錄更多新功能”;} else{echo“更新記錄時出錯:”.$conn->;Error;}

        査詢數據:通過SELECT語句可以査詢數據。

$sql=“; 從myTable中選擇id、名字、姓氏$ 結果=$conn->; 査詢($sql); if($result->;num_rows>;0){//輸出每個行的數據while($row=$result-<;fetch_assoc()){echo“id:”.$row[“id”].“-名稱:”.$row[“名字”].0結果";;}

        最後,記得在完成所有操作後,關閉資料庫連接:

$conn->; close();

這只是最基本的資料庫操作示例,依據自己對PHP和SQL的瞭解,你可以進行更複雜的操作。 務必注意,像以上的示例在實際應用中,需要加入更為嚴謹的異常處理以及安全防護手段,防止SQL注入等安全問題。